Excepción

Cómo aplicar Try Catch Block en PHP

Cómo aplicar Try Catch Block en PHP

Las siguientes palabras clave se utilizan para el manejo de excepciones de PHP.

  1. Intentar: el bloque try contiene el código que puede generar una excepción. ...
  2. Throw: la palabra clave throw se usa para señalar la ocurrencia de una excepción de PHP. ...
  3. Captura: este bloque de código se llamará solo si ocurre una excepción dentro del bloque de código de prueba.

  1. ¿Cómo puedo intentar atrapar en PHP??
  2. ¿Cómo puedo obtener el código de error de una excepción en PHP??
  3. Por que usamos try and catch en PHP?
  4. ¿Cómo se usa try catch?
  5. ¿Cómo puedo obtener el error 500 en php??
  6. ¿Qué es PHP intenta atrapar??
  7. ¿Cuál es la diferencia entre error y excepción en PHP??
  8. ¿Qué es el manejo de errores de PHP??
  9. ¿Cómo obtengo un código de excepción??
  10. ¿Cómo puedo obtener un mensaje de error en PHP??
  11. ¿Qué es PDOException PHP??
  12. ¿Cuántos tipos de excepciones hay en PHP??

¿Cómo puedo intentar atrapar en PHP??

Intenta, lanza y atrapa

  1. try: una función que utilice una excepción debe estar en un bloque "try". Si la excepción no se activa, el código continuará con normalidad. ...
  2. lanzar: así es como se activa una excepción. ...
  3. catch: un bloque "catch" recupera una excepción y crea un objeto que contiene la información de la excepción.

¿Cómo puedo obtener el código de error de una excepción en PHP??

Método getCode () de excepción PHP

El método getCode () devuelve un número entero que se puede utilizar para identificar la excepción.

Por que usamos try and catch en PHP?

probar: representa un bloque de código en el que puede surgir una excepción. captura: representa un bloque de código que se ejecutará cuando se haya lanzado una excepción en particular. throw: se usa para lanzar una excepción. También se usa para enumerar las excepciones que arroja una función, pero no se maneja sola.

¿Cómo se usa try catch?

Coloque cualquier declaración de código que pueda generar o lanzar una excepción en un bloque try, y coloque las declaraciones utilizadas para manejar la excepción o excepciones en uno o más bloques catch debajo del bloque try. Cada bloque de captura incluye el tipo de excepción y puede contener declaraciones adicionales necesarias para manejar ese tipo de excepción.

¿Cómo puedo obtener el error 500 en php??

A continuación, se muestran los pasos de solución de problemas comunes que se pueden seguir para resolver un error interno del servidor 500:

  1. Verifique los registros de errores.
  2. Comprobar el . archivo htaccess.
  3. Consulta tus recursos PHP.
  4. Verifique los scripts CGI / Perl.

¿Qué es PHP intenta atrapar??

Intentar: el bloque try contiene el código que puede generar una excepción. ... Captura: este bloque de código se llamará solo si ocurre una excepción dentro del bloque de código de prueba. El código dentro de su declaración de captura debe manejar la excepción que se lanzó. Finalmente: en PHP 5.5, se introduce la declaración final.

¿Cuál es la diferencia entre error y excepción en PHP??

Error: un error es un resultado inesperado del programa, que no puede ser manejado por el programa en sí. ... Excepción: una excepción también es un resultado inesperado de un programa, pero el programa mismo puede manejar la excepción lanzando otra excepción.

¿Qué es el manejo de errores de PHP??

El manejo de errores en PHP es simple. Se envía al navegador un mensaje de error con nombre de archivo, número de línea y un mensaje que describe el error.

¿Cómo obtengo un código de excepción??

  1. Ejecute el código, coloque un punto de interrupción en su bloque de captura y use el depurador para ver la excepción y ver qué información tiene. - ...
  2. Alternativamente, puede ejecutar el código sin molestarse en depurar e imprimir el tipo de excepción con GetType ().

¿Cómo puedo obtener un mensaje de error en PHP??

La forma más rápida de mostrar todos los errores y advertencias de php es agregar estas líneas a su archivo de código PHP: ini_set ('display_errors', 1); ini_set ('display_startup_errors', 1); error_reporting (E_ALL); La función ini_set intentará anular la configuración que se encuentra en su php. archivo ini.

¿Qué es PDOException PHP??

Los objetos de datos PHP (o PDO) son una colección de API e interfaces que intentan simplificar y consolidar las diversas formas en que se puede acceder a las bases de datos y manipularlas en un paquete singular. Por lo tanto, la PDOException se lanza cada vez que algo sale mal al usar la clase PDO o extensiones relacionadas.

¿Cuántos tipos de excepciones hay en PHP??

A partir de PHP 7, PHP divide los errores en dos clases únicas: excepción y error . Un error se utiliza normalmente para problemas que históricamente se han considerado errores fatales. Cuando ocurre un error fatal, PHP ahora lanzará una instancia de clase Error.

La guía completa para usar ffmpeg en Linux
¿Cómo ejecuto FFmpeg en Linux?? ¿Cómo uso el comando FFmpeg?? ¿Cómo configuro FFmpeg?? ¿Dónde está la ruta de Ffmpeg en Linux?? ¿Funciona Ffmpeg en Li...
Cómo habilitar Event MPM en Apache 2.4 en CentOS / RHEL 7
Primero edite el archivo de configuración de Apache MPM en su editor de texto favorito. Comente la línea LoadModule para mpm_prefork_module, mpm_worke...
Instale KVM en Ubuntu 20.04
Cómo instalar KVM en Ubuntu 20.04 Paso 1 Verifique el soporte de virtualización en Ubuntu. Antes de instalar KVM en Ubuntu, primero verificaremos si e...